Mary Ellen Williams was born December 1, 1939 in Aurora, Colorado to Marie (Tiernan) and Walter A. Dick. She passed away Saturday, August 29, 2020 at her home in Canute, Oklahoma at the age of 80 years, 8 months and 28 days.

Mary Ellen grew up moving around from military base to military base. Her family settled down at Tinker Air Force Base in Midwest City, Oklahoma. It was here where she met Richard David Williams, Sr. and they were later married on June 20, 1959 at St. Phillip Neri Catholic Church in Midwest City, Oklahoma. They were blessed with five children; David, Julic, Doug, John, and Suzanne. Mary Ellen worked as a clerk typist at Tinker and later moved to Germany following Richard's promotion in the FAA. They returned to the U.S. and lived in San Antonio, TX, Burns Flat, OK and finally settling on their 5 acres south of Canute, OK. After being an administrative assistant for the FAA she opened the tag agency in Canute. It was here that many of the owners of the car dealerships in western Oklahoma came to know Mary Ellen and her work ethic. Mary Ellen was a devote Catholic and raised her family in the church and took pride in her faith, family and friends. She also enjoyed quilting, attending the women's guild, being a seamstress and being an avid reader of history.
